From Cars to Cities: Toyota’s Radical Shift
At the 2020 Consumer Electronics Show, Toyota CEO Akio Toyoda unveiled a vision that stunned the tech world: a city where engineers, researchers, and scientists could live, work, and innovate under one roof. The goal wasn’t just to build cars—it was to transform Toyota into a mobility company, one that addresses urban challenges with data-driven solutions. Woven City was born as the physical manifestation of this ambition.
Six months ago, the first wave of residents—100 carefully selected “Weavers”—moved into this futuristic enclave. These pioneers weren’t just employees; they were handpicked for their expertise in robotics, AI, and sustainable design. Their mission? To test and refine technologies that could one day redefine how cities operate. The city’s infrastructure is as experimental as its residents: sensor-laden streets, hydrogen-powered homes, and AI-driven logistics systems are all part of the package.
Life in a Sensor-Driven Utopia
Walking through Woven City feels like stepping into a sci-fi narrative—but with one critical difference: it’s real. Every corner of the 175-acre site is embedded with sensors, monitoring everything from air quality to pedestrian traffic. The goal isn’t surveillance for its own sake; it’s to create a responsive environment where infrastructure adapts in real time to the needs of its inhabitants.
Residents live in smart homes built with eco-friendly materials, equipped with AI assistants that manage energy use, security, and even grocery orders. The city’s streets are divided into zones for pedestrians, cyclists, and autonomous vehicles, all governed by a centralized traffic management system. Even the buildings are modular, allowing for quick reconfiguration as needs evolve.
Yet for all its high-tech trappings, Woven City remains a work in progress. Early feedback from residents suggests that while the innovations are impressive, the human element still requires fine-tuning. Balancing automation with livability is no small feat—especially when the entire community operates under a single corporate vision.
The Big Questions: Privacy, Scale, and the Future
Woven City’s most controversial feature might be its data collection practices. With cameras and sensors monitoring nearly every public space, questions about privacy are inevitable. Toyota has framed the project as a closed ecosystem, where data is used strictly for research and infrastructure optimization. But as smart cities become more common, the ethical implications of such pervasive monitoring will only grow harder to ignore.
Then there’s the issue of scale. Woven City is a testbed, not a template for mass adoption—at least not yet. For Toyota, the real challenge will be translating these innovations into solutions that work beyond the confines of a private community. Can the lessons learned here be applied to real-world cities? And will other corporations follow suit, building their own tech-driven enclaves?
